ATTN HBCU bound or attending alum: The Dallas Mavericks are teaming up with the United Negro College Fund to provide five (5) additional college scholarships to DFW-based, HBCU students. All student classifications are encouraged to apply from incoming freshmen to seniors. All Mavs College Scholarship recipients will receive on-going mentoring from Dallas Mavericks staff and opportunities for Mavs summer jobs, potential internships or other work experience.
This scholarship can be applied to any accredited UNCF member institution or another accredited HBCU that is either in or out of state. Application deadline is August 31 at 11:59 PM.

The DeSoto Public Library will host this event on Saturday August 13, 3:00 pm -5:30 pm in the amphitheater behind the library!
The library will celebrate all readers of all ages and all levels who participated in the annual Mayor’s Summer Reading Club. So, grab your towels for a wet afternoon of water activities, inflatable slides, crafts, games, snacks, and much more! This will also be the final opportunity to pick up your summer reading prizes, as well as announce the Grand Prize Winners for the Summer Reading Program!
This program is free and open to all ages. No registration required. For any questions, call the library at 972-230-9661.
